How Cameron and Clegg are planning illiberal changes to justice system - mikebratcher69 - 9 January 2012 Nick Clegg added that after years of Labour authoritarianism, theirs would be a government ‘that hands you back your liberties’. Now, however, almost unnoticed, this same Government is planning to enact highly illiberal changes to the justice system. If, as Mr Cameron intends, they become law later this year, the consequences will be an unprecedented growth of secret hearings in both civil court cases and inquests; to deny ordinary citizens the ancient Common Law right to challenge evidence against them; and to make it far more difficult to call wrongdoing by government agencies to account. http://www.dailymail.co.uk/news/article-2083768/Secret-justice-How-Cameron-Clegg-vowed-hand-liberties-instead-planning-illiberal-changes-justice-system.html |
